MEXICO CITY (Reuters) – The election of a veteran lawmaker of the previous ruling social gathering to lead the union of state oil agency Petroleos Mexicanos (Pemex) strikes an influential piece of Mexico’s old energy construction closer to President Andres Manuel Lopez Obrador, who blessed the vote.

Lopez Obrador on Tuesday stated Monday’s vote gained by Ricardo Aldana, treasurer of the union and an ally of longstanding boss Carlos Romero Deschamps, was a historic train in labor freedoms that had damaged with rigged elections of the previous.

“The system labored,” the president instructed a information convention. “It used to be that the choice on who was in and who was out was made right here” he stated in an obvious reference to the presidency. “Now, it is up to the employees. As to who gained and their background, that is a matter for the labor ministry.”

Reviving Pemex, Mexico’s largest agency, is considered one of Lopez Obrador’s high priorities and politicians noticed his obvious lodging with the union as an indication of the pragmatism he has proven in increasing his energy base throughout the political panorama. That may strengthen his hand in elections.

But rival candidates, and critics on the left and proper, argue the election may entrench the old union management, which has had a troubled historical past and led to Romero Deschamps stepping down in 2019 amid allegations of corruption.

Romero Deschamps has denied the allegations and isn’t going through fees of wrongdoing, nor has he been convicted of any crime. Aldana in the course of the marketing campaign denied taking cues from his former boss as rivals raised issues about their previous ties.

Spokespersons for Aldana and the union didn’t reply to requests for remark. The workplace of Lopez Obrador, who pressured he had no ties to Aldana, didn’t reply to a request for remark. Romero Deschamps couldn’t be reached.

Ahead of the election, Aldana stated if chosen he would work to higher the lives of Pemex employees and their households, enhance productiveness, and overhaul the union management to give attention to transparency and accountability.

The labor ministry stated if confirmed as winner, Aldana’s time period would run by the tip of 2024.

Aldana and Romero Deschamps served in Congress for the Institutional Revolutionary Party (PRI), which dominated Mexico for a lot of the twentieth century and in 1938 created Pemex.

Until 2000, the PRI reigned supreme in Mexico, with presidents concentrating govt energy and Pemex serving as a key supply of contracts, and pillar of financial growth.

Such was the proximity between the social gathering and the Pemex union that in an issue dubbed ‘Pemexgate’, prosecutors accused Romero Deschamps and others of funneling thousands and thousands from Pemex into the PRI’s failed presidential bid in 2000.

They weren’t convicted, however experiences about union leaders’ wealth continued to canine their repute.

Clemente Castaneda, a senator for the opposition center-left Citizens’ Movement social gathering, stated Aldana’s election amounted to “extra of the identical” for a tainted system.

Lopez Obrador, who was a member of the PRI till the late Nineteen Eighties, spent years pillorying the social gathering for corruption.

But these days he has pressed the PRI, now in opposition, to assist him go vitality market laws.

Critics forged the president’s ambiguous perspective to the social gathering and his blessing for the Pemex vote as a manner of tightening political management as his National Regeneration Movement (MORENA) gears up to choose a successor to him in 2024.

Fernando Belaunzaran, an opposition politician, stated good relations between the Pemex union and the president had been mutually helpful and will assist sway elections.

“(Lopez Obrador) is rebuilding the old PRI in MORENA,” he stated.
